Free Meta Tag Generator for SEO and Social Media

Meta tags are HTML elements that provide information about your web page to search engines and social media platforms. Well-crafted meta tags improve your search rankings, increase click-through rates, and control how your content appears when shared on social media.

Essential Meta Tags for Every Page

Title Tag: The most important on-page SEO element. Keep it under 60 characters to avoid truncation in search results. Include your primary keyword near the beginning and make it compelling enough to click.

Meta Description: A 150-160 character summary of your page content. While not a direct ranking factor, a well-written description dramatically improves click-through rates from search results. Include a call-to-action and your key value proposition.

Robots Meta Tag: Controls how search engines index and follow links on your page. Use index, follow for most pages, noindex for pages you don't want in search results, and nofollow when you don't want search engines to follow outbound links.

Open Graph Tags for Social Media

Open Graph (OG) tags control how your content appears when shared on Facebook, LinkedIn, and other social platforms. The key tags are:

  • og:title — The title displayed in social shares
  • og:description — The description shown below the title
  • og:image — The preview image (recommended: 1200x630px)
  • og:type — Content type (website, article, product)
  • og:url — The canonical URL of the page

Twitter Card Tags

Twitter uses its own card tags to format shared links. The two main types are:

Summary Card: Shows a small thumbnail with title and description. Good for articles and general content.

Summary Large Image: Shows a large image above the title and description. Better for visual content, blog posts, and products.

Common Meta Tag Mistakes

  • Duplicate title tags across multiple pages
  • Meta descriptions that are too long (truncated) or too short (not compelling)
  • Missing OG image tags (social shares look plain without images)
  • Using the same meta description for every page
  • Keyword stuffing in title tags

Frequently Asked Questions

What are meta tags and why are they important?
Meta tags are HTML elements in the <head> section of your page that provide information to search engines and social media platforms. They control how your page appears in search results and social shares, affecting click-through rates and traffic.
How long should my title tag be?
Keep title tags under 60 characters to avoid truncation in Google search results. Include your primary keyword near the beginning and make it compelling. Format: Primary Keyword — Secondary Keyword | Brand Name.
What is the ideal meta description length?
Meta descriptions should be 150-160 characters. Google may truncate descriptions longer than 160 characters. Write a concise summary that includes your main keyword and a call-to-action to encourage clicks.
What size should OG images be?
The recommended Open Graph image size is 1200x630 pixels (1.91:1 ratio). This ensures your image displays well on Facebook, LinkedIn, Twitter, and other platforms. Use high-contrast images with minimal text for best results.
